Other than annual maintenance, there are a few basic things you can do to make certain dependable and reliable procedures. Make sure to transform or clean your air filter every 3 months, as clogged up filters will certainly decrease air movement and decrease the efficiency of your system. Also, make sure that vents and air signs up in your home are not blocked by furniture or carpeting, as insufficient air flow to or from your unit can reduce equipment life-spans and minimize performance of the system.

An open system uses ground water from a conventional well as a heat source. The ground water is pumped to a warmth exchanger, where thermal energy is removed and used as a resource for the heat pump. The ground water exiting the warm exchanger is after that reinjected right into the aquifer.

Stage one asks for heat from the heatpump if the temperature drops listed below the pre-set level. Phase two require heat from the supplemental heating system if the interior temperature continues to fall listed below the desired temperature. Ductless property air-source heatpump are typically mounted with a single phase heating/cooling thermostat or in numerous instances a built in thermostat set by a remote that includes the system. For air-based systems, self-contained devices integrate the blower, compressor, warmth exchanger, and condenser coil in a solitary cupboard. Split systems enable the coil to be added to a forced-air furnace, and make use of the existing blower and heater.

Heatpump systems normally provide a better quantity of air movement at lower temperature level compared to furnace systems. Therefore, mini split it is very vital to examine the supply air movement of your system, and exactly how it may contrast to the air flow ability of your existing ducts. If the heat pump airflow exceeds the capacity of your existing ducting, you might have sound problems or enhanced fan power usage.

Air-to-air heat pumps offer hot or chilly air straight to rooms, yet do not generally supply warm water. Air-to-water heat pumps utilize radiators or underfloor home heating to heat an entire home and are often likewise used to provide residential hot water. In Canada, where air temperatures can go below-- 30 ° C, ground-source systems have the ability to run much more efficiently due to the fact that they make the most of warmer and much more steady ground temperature levels. Typical water temperatures entering the ground-source heat pump are usually over 0 ° C, yielding a COP of around 3 for most systems throughout the chilliest winter months.

A heat pump uses innovation comparable to that located in a refrigerator or an air conditioner. It extracts heat1 from a source, such as the bordering air, geothermal energy stored in the ground, or close-by sources of water or waste warm from a factory. Since a lot of the warmth is moved as opposed to generated, heat pumps are much more reliable than standard home heating innovations such as central heating boilers or electric heating systems and can be more affordable to run.
